New Zealand and India will face each other in the 3rd and final T20I of the series on Tuesday. The 1st T20I was abandoned with a ball being bowled. Visitors India completely outplayed New Zealand by 65 runs in the 2nd T20I to go 1-0 up in the series. Kiwis are out of the race to win the series however have an opportunity to level 1-1.

Pre-Match Analysis:
New Zealand are in a must-win situation to save the series. Their batters were kept under control throughout the 2nd T20I and they went on lose the game by 65 runs. Kane Williamson played a lone hand in the run-chase, scoring 61 runs which weren’t sufficient to win the game. Earlier their bowlers were taken to the cleaners by Suryakumar Yadav who played an entertaining knock. Tim Southee will lead the side in this game in the absence of Kane Williamson who has a medical appointment and Mark Chapman will replace him in the squad. They need to change their approach at the top of the order to get desired results.
New look Team India ticked all boxes correctly under the leadership of Hardik Pandya and took a 1-0 lead in the series with a facile win in the 2nd T20I by 65 runs. Suryakumar Yadav’s 2nd T20I century helped them to post 191 runs on the board and later with the collective bowling efforts they bowled out the kiwis for just 126 runs. They are not in the mood to make many changes to their playing for this game.
